Fender Player II Mustang Bass PJ – Iconic Short Scale Versatility

The Fender Player II Mustang Bass PJ MN Cactus Gray is designed to put classic Fender tone and effortless playability into a compact, contemporary package. This model combines a stage-ready PJ pickup set with a comfortable short-scale neck, making it a top choice for bassists seeking both tradition and modern flexibility. Featuring a Cactus Gray finish and maple fingerboard, the Mustang attracts attention visually, while advanced hardware and thoughtful neck design ensure both style and substance in play.

Modern Updates with Classic Fender DNA

Unique in its class, the Player II Mustang Bass PJ offers the rare combination of a 30" (762 mm) scale, rolled fingerboard edges, and a Player Series PJ pickup arrangement. A Modern "C" neck profile and satin urethane finish contribute to a smooth, fast feel suitable for demanding gigs or extended sessions. Blending Precision and Jazz Bass tones, along with a solid alder body and robust hardware, ensures that this instrument fits seamlessly into both stage and studio environments.

Short Scale Comfort for Expressive Performance

A shorter scale length delivers a warmer attack and less string tension, ideal for players with smaller hands or those seeking a vintage feel. Portability is also enhanced, encouraging expressive bends and slides.

  • Scale Length: 762 mm — enables agile fretting and a unique, punchy tone
  • With a Fingerboard Radius of 241 mm, you can expect a comfortable curve for both chords and fast lines.
  • Frets: 19 medium jumbo — supports dynamic techniques and a smooth playing surface

Versatile Pickup System for Any Genre

The PJ pickup setup combines the fullness of a split Precision Bass pickup with the articulation of a Jazz Bass single-coil. Use the 3-way toggle switch to select either pickup or blend them for a wide palette of classic and modern sounds. This layout provides the flexibility to transition from deep, vintage thump to clear, modern bite quickly.

  • Pickups: Player Series Alnico V Split P-Bass + Alnico V Single-Coil J-Bass — switchable for tone shaping
  • Controls: Master Volume, Master Tone — straightforward yet powerful sound control
  • Switch between pickup voices easily using the 3-position toggle for instant access to a variety of tones.

Hardware Built for Reliable Performance

Hardware on this Mustang is selected for accuracy and durability. A 4-saddle bridge with single-groove steel "barrel" saddles ensures solid intonation, while open-gear tuners and a synthetic bone nut provide stable tuning even during intense play. Nickel/chrome hardware and a 3-ply parchment pickguard enhance both appearance and resilience.

  • Bridge: 4-saddle vintage style — allows precise setup for each string
  • Tuners: Open-gear vintage style — classic aesthetics paired with reliable tuning
  • Players who prefer a fast neck feel for different hand sizes will appreciate the Nut Width: 38.1 mm.

Body

Body: Alder

Alder is a medium-weight wood that produces a well-balanced tone with a strong mid-range, bright highs and moderate bass. It is known for its warm and full sound, making it a versatile material for a variety of musical styles.

Neck

Neck: Maple

Maple is known for its strength and stability, making it ideal for necks that need to resist bending and warping.

Fretboard

Fretboard: Maple

The maple fingerboard is valued for its smoothness and strength, while offering excellent playability and a clear, articulate sound. It is popular for its bright appearance and its ability to maintain accurate and detailed sound while playing.
